The History of Casinos in the UK

The history of casinos in the UK dates back to the early 1960s with the Betting and Gaming Act of 1960, which legalized casinos in Britain. This act laid the groundwork for the establishment of licensed casinos, allowing for games such as roulette, blackjack, and baccarat to be played legally. Over the decades, the gaming landscape has changed, leading to the establishment of numerous casinos across the country, including iconic establishments like The Ritz Club in London and the popular Grosvenor Casinos chain.

Types of Casinos in the UK

Casinos in the UK can primarily be categorized into two types: land-based and online casinos.

Land-Based Casinos

Land-based casinos are physical establishments where players can enjoy a variety of games. The UK boasts over 140 licensed casinos, each offering different gaming experiences, entertainment options, and cuisine. Some casinos also host events like poker tournaments, live shows, and more. Major cities such as London, Manchester, and Edinburgh offer some of the biggest and most luxurious casinos, tailored to various tastes and budgets.

Online Casinos

The online casino sector has exploded since the early 2000s, propelled by advancements in technology and the increasing availability of the internet. Online casinos in the UK provide a wide selection of games, including slots, poker, and table games, accessible from the comfort of one’s home. They often provide enticing bonuses and promotions to attract new players. Players must ensure that they choose licensed operators governed by the UK Gambling Commission to ensure fair play and player protection.

Regulation and Licensing

One of the most significant aspects of the casino landscape in the UK is its regulation. The UK Gambling Commission oversees the licensing and regulation of gambling activities, ensuring operators adhere to strict standards. This regulatory framework is designed to protect players from fraud and ensure that gambling is conducted fairly and responsibly. All casinos, whether land-based or online, must hold a valid license from the UK Gambling Commission to operate legally.

Popular Casino Games

Whether you’re visiting a land-based casino or playing online, you’ll find a wide range of games. Some of the most popular include:

  • Slots: Online and offline slots come in various themes, styles, and configurations, attracting players with their colorful graphics and engaging gameplay.
  • Roulette: A classic casino game offering various betting options, including inside bets and outside bets, attracting both novices and seasoned players alike.
  • Blackjack: Known for its simple rules and strategic depth, this card game is a favorite among gamblers looking for skill and chance.
  • Poker: With multiple variants, including Texas Hold’em and Omaha, poker rooms attract players seeking competition and strategic gameplay.
  • Baccarat: A game of chance favored by high-rollers, baccarat has enjoyed a resurgence in popularity, especially online.
